gogogo 发表于 2005-9-18 08:13:47

[09.18] 使用ERP压制DVDrip-RMVB入门教程

基本概念

DVDRip:是最终版本DVD的转制。是avi格式,在AVI文件中,视频信息和伴音信息是分别存储的,因此可以把一段AVI文件中的视频与另一个AVI文件中的伴音合成在一起。AVI文件结构不仅解决了音频和视频的同步问题,而且具有通用和开放的特点。它可以在任何Windows环境下工作,很多软件都可以对AVI视频直接进行编辑处理。

rm(RealMedia)RealMedia 应该说是最流行的网络流媒体格式之一了,正是它的诞生,才使得网络视频得以广泛应用。令人惊叹的是,在用 56K Modem拨号上网的条件下,RM依旧可以实现不间断地视频播放。此外,RM类似于MPEG4,可以自行设定编码速率,而且也具备动态补偿,在512Kbps以上的编码速率时,RM的画质高于VCD。但是,在相同的编码速率下,RM的画质还是不如MPEG4。

RMVB:为了改变RealMedia不适合高画质视频存储的缺陷,Real公司推出了RMVB格式。VB即VBR,是Variable Bit Rate(可改变比特率)的英文缩写。影片的里静止画面和运动画面对压缩比率的要求是不同的,如果始终保持固定的比特率,会对文件容量造成浪费,而且在大动态视频场面时画质不佳。
   RMVB打破了原先RM格式那种自始自终保持固定压缩比的方式,引入了动态压缩比率,将较高的比特率用于复杂的动态画面(歌舞、飞车、战争等),而在静态画面时则灵活地转为较低的编码率,合理地利用了比特率资源。这样在平均编码率不变的情况下,可以进一步改善视频画质。

DVDRip的优缺点
优点是画质高,其字幕一般是外挂方式,比较灵活。缺点是文件个头太大,外挂字幕虽然灵活,也造成了播放的复杂性。另外,DVDRip的视频和音频的编码格式有很多种,要正确的播放,必须安装一大堆插件。

RMVB的优点
RMVB格式虽然不如DVDRip清晰,但其画质也是比较好的。它个头小,播放方便。这些都是DVDRip所不及的。

综上所述,DVDRip转制成RMVB是很有必要的。转制(压缩)的软件有很多种,比较常用的有RealProuducer Plus,Easy Realmedia Producer(ERP)等。

gogogo 发表于 2005-9-18 08:50:47

推荐的压缩工具:

Easy RealMedia Producer

  这是一个批量RealMedia文件生成器。采用全新的RealVideo9&RealVideo10内核。软件根据实际使用的需要提供了比Helix RealMedia Producer和RealProducer10还要多的过滤设置。基本上可以用它来替代Helix RealMedia Producer和RealProducer10,使用Real10内核时,全面支持Real10文件编码,并提供Real8、Real9兼容的编码支持。
  选这个的原因是因为这是个全中文的软件,当然有好多功能我们一般用不到的,现在我们就从简单的开始压制吧!


步骤1:下载安装

首先点这里下载新版的EasyRealMediaProducerV1.8
http://redcheek.net/erm/ermp_full.zip

安装时会出现如图画面

http://bbs.btmyth.com/attachments/day_050918/108_vXPnsMEZ1Z1k_9QpHqC3baz84.jpg

这里只需将语言选为简体中文即可。

安装好后,桌面出现下面的图标


http://bbs.btmyth.com/attachments/day_050918/112_5efTP1FdtNsS_IM46HpXDhyx8.jpg



步骤2:选择要压缩的文件

运行后的界面如下,单击添加按纽选则你要压制的AVI电影



http://bbs.btmyth.com/attachments/day_050918/2_ILVnrr0DcDvw.jpg


步骤3:参数设置

选择好全部要压缩的文件后还要进行参数设置,先选定其中一个,点参数设置进行设置,如图:


http://bbs.btmyth.com/attachments/day_050918/3_ZJotQ8isyxW1.jpg

请大家先按照下图中的的来设置好参数,由于这只是个傻瓜式的教程不做太多深入解释,只给大家讲讲各个参数设置的用途:


http://bbs.btmyth.com/attachments/day_050918/1_cPAnbV3S1Q3i.jpg


1. 关于压缩设置一项的设置,压过片的应该都清楚的,用来设定压制时的码率,动态码率 最大码率和平均码率越大则压好的电影(此指BMVB文件)体积就越大,太低就会影响影片质量,这里我们只针对电影来设置,平均码率我个人认为最高不要超过600,最低不要低于450,动态码率建议不要超过1200(一般动作大片用个1000~1100其实也足够了),动作画面不是太多的话可以设定为1000,这样基本可以在保证画质的基础上压缩电影了.

      ①片源较好(如DVD9等)的动作片,场景较大的影片(如指环王,黑客帝国)最大码率一般在1000~1100左右,平均码率最大不要超过600!
      ②片源一般(如DVD,VCD,DVDrip格式)的,这是压制中占绝大多数的部分,一般最大码率设定在950~1100,平均码率设定在500基本可以在保持画质的基础上压出体积适中的电影了.
      ③片源较差的,这里主要指一些枪版影片,这类影片最大码率设定在900~950,平均码率400就可以了


2.关于视频模式的设置

Normal Motion Video普通效果...
Smoothest Motion   经几次测试后建议不用!
Sharpest Image         适合动画,电影压制!
Slide Show               记得是幻灯片模式,用这个压画面会一顿顿的类似播放幻灯片
No Video                  选这个则不进行视频压缩

视频编码就选RealVideo 9吧,选10我觉得是浪费时间而且效果差异不大....


3.关于音频编码的设置当然是选越大越好了,看你的耳朵喜欢怎样的吧,不过不能太大,大了也会影响生成的RMVB的体积的,音量直接调到最大12不用多解释了吧...



步骤4 压制时外挂字幕和水印

   压制时需要加入论坛统一的水印,此时首先安装VOBSUB字幕外挂软件,然后将水印和要压制的电影文件放在同一个文件夹内,并且用相同的文件名,用ERP压制时就会自动挂上水印.播放影片时也能看见水印效果!


http://bbs.btmyth.com/attachments/day_050918/5_bUisZHFiFLz8.jpg


点击附件下载论坛水印

打开水印

将壓製人:dyqz2003”“改成你的ID。
以后使用时,只需将ssa文件的名称改成你要压制的片子相同的名字,并放到同一个文件夹即可.

[ Last edited by gogogo on 2005-9-18 at 01:47 ]

gogogo 发表于 2005-9-18 09:57:55

1.VOBSUB 挂字幕软件

软件说明:在影片播放同时显示中文字幕、VirtualDub从VOB调用字幕流(支持CC字幕)的插件、调整各种字幕时间码、 字幕格式转换、OCR制作文本字幕等。
先下载附件安装好里面的 VobSub_2.23.exe
然后将DLL.RAR包中的VSFilter.dll和unrar.dll 复制到 %WINDOWS%/system32 目录后,点击开始菜单中的运行输入 regsvr32 VSfilter.dll点确定即可。
然后进入VOBSUB软件的属性设置,进行简单设置即可,其他保持默认:


http://bbs.btmyth.com/attachments/day_050918/102_6QxtX58SPQi8_jQ9P5aaQrgoF.jpg

注意!“缓冲字幕图像”不能有勾。这是为了显示ssa水印动态效果!

设置字型:

注意:sub字幕是图形格式,我们无法改变它的字体,ssa字幕里自己定义了字体、字号等。因此这里的设置字型,仅对srt字幕起作用。
到“主控”选项卡

http://bbs.btmyth.com/attachments/day_050918/7_McHe1gXP6jWQ.jpg

[ Last edited by gogogo on 2005-9-18 at 02:14 ]

gogogo 发表于 2005-9-18 10:12:23

压缩时挂双字幕的办法!

要实现同时挂字幕和水印:     
一、安装文件
1.ac3filter_0_70b.exe
2.AviSynth_253.exe
3.ffdshow-20030523.exe
4.VobSub_2.23.exe
以上四个按照着默认向导安装就行了


使用ffdshow加挂水印:


水印其实也是一个字幕。我们的目的是:在播放时同时加载影片字幕和水印,也就是加载双字幕。上楼也已经讲过,可以用VobSub来加载字幕,但它无法同时加载双字幕。因此我们需要把加载水印字幕的任务交给其他的插件,这里用的是ffdshow。

首先将下面的代码编写一个后缀名为sva的文件,


2000系统
loadplugin("C:\WINNT\system32\VSFilter.dll")
TextSub("E:\VCD\1\2ssa")
xp系统
loadplugin("C:\WINDOWS\system32\VSFilter.dll")
TextSub("E:\VCD\1\2ssa")

我使用的是xp系统,所以编写为

loadplugin("C:\WINDOWS\system32\VSFilter.dll")
TextSub("E:\VCD\1\2ssa")

注意: ("E:\VCD\1\2ssa")这个括号内的就是指你的ssa水印在你硬盘内的存放路径!,你的水印放在硬盘什么地方就填上去

写好以后保存在运行ffdshow,找到avisynth。把前面的打勾,在点击进入把刚才编辑好的avs文件添加进去。


http://bbs.btmyth.com/attachments/day_050918/8_TnjwAjY620Ng.jpg


这样,我们就成功的解决了外挂双字幕的问题。

[ Last edited by gogogo on 2005-9-18 at 02:54 ]

柏林上的天使 发表于 2005-10-5 06:52:02

谢谢老大!
一直想学习一下找不到教程!
现在好了!
自己试试去了!

ps1111 发表于 2005-11-17 20:48:11

顶了,可是怎么把DVD变成AVI的格式呢?老大请指教

dongnanfeng 发表于 2005-11-25 22:04:42

请教一下,还有啊.俺最近下了几个片子,完成以后竟然是zip图标.能帮助讲解一下吗?

翔天羽 发表于 2005-11-29 17:02:42

正在下载,,有时间研究一下

mmbo2005 发表于 2006-1-12 09:58:29

收藏下来,谢谢楼主!

dingdong_1982 发表于 2006-1-13 20:47:14

1

谢谢老大
我学会压了
页: [1] 2 3 4
查看完整版本: [09.18] 使用ERP压制DVDrip-RMVB入门教程